Syllogistic

Definition:

Syllogistic (adjective) refers to the form of deductive reasoning or argumentation in which a conclusion is drawn from two premises. It involves a specific pattern of logical reasoning based on categorical statements.

Sense 1 - Logic:

In logic, syllogistic (adjective) describes the method of using syllogisms, which are structured arguments consisting of three categorical propositions: a major premise, a minor premise, and a conclusion.

Example sentence: He studied syllogistic reasoning to improve his logical thinking skills.
